How many photovoltaic panels are there in 10kW

A typical 10kW solar system requires between 25 and 40 solar panels, depending on the wattage of each individual panel. This article delves into the factors influencing the panel count and provides a comprehensive guide to understanding your solar needs. [PDF Version]

How many photovoltaic panels are required for a 10kW inverter

A 10kW solar system typically requires 25–34 panels, depending on panel wattage. Key factors include solar irradiance, panel efficiency (18%–22% for monocrystalline), and daily sun. [PDF Version]

665 How much does it cost to make photovoltaic panels

The total cost of producing solar panels encompasses multiple components, including raw materials (30-40%), labor (15-25%), energy consumption (10-15%), equipment depreciation (20-30%), and overhead expenses (5-15%). [PDF Version]
